northwind 11-10-06 08:44 AM

Probably not a lot of difference then. I love my F Fabbri screen, it doesn't make me faster but it does make me more comfortable when going fast. Doesn't totally divert the blast off my head but it means don't get it in the face.

All depends on the rider and riding position how well a particular screen works though. My nuvo used to batter me in the face and neck, but I know a shorter rider who loves his, because his head's that much lower down than mine :)

Don't really know about the touring screens, but from the looks of it it'll deflect more air at the expense of aerodynamics. Which are rubbish on any bike anyway, so it's probably not much of a loss. Might be beter for the real world in fact.
